You bought the gear… now what?

In this episode of Snohomish Podcast Playground, Trent walks you through how to set up your podcast equipment step-by-step—starting with the most overlooked part: where you record. Because the wrong room can make even great microphones sound like you’re talking in a cave.


What we cover in this episode

  • Pick the right recording space (and which spaces to avoid)
  • Simple ways to reduce echo using what you already have: books, rugs, curtains, clothes, blankets
  • How to set up your mic stand so your gear stays stable (and doesn’t crash mid-recording)
  • XLR basics: what plugs where, and how to get that “click” connection
  • How to connect your mic to a mixer/recorder (and why channel numbers matter)
  • Headphone setup tips (including when you’ll need a ¼-inch adapter)
  • Gain vs. fader/slider: a beginner-friendly way to set levels without getting overwhelmed
  • Why you should test your full setup before a guest shows up (and how to “playground test” it)


The big takeaway

You don’t need a perfect studio—you need a good space, a clean connection, and a little time to test and play before you record for real.
